-
Absolute
Section
(绝对段)
具备不可被链接器改变的固定(绝对)地址的段。
Access
RAM
(存取
RAM
,仅限
PI
C18CXXX
系列器件)
这是数据存储器
RAM
中的一个区间,无论目
前所选的存储体为何均可对其进行访问。有了它,
即可通过指令访问特殊功能寄存器而无
须改变所选存储体。
存取
RAM
还包括
一些通用寄存器
(
G
PR
)
。它对于在上下文切换期间(如中断期间)保存所需变量很有用处。当用于
引用
PIC18CX
XX
器件时,存取
RAM
指无论存储体选择位(
BSR
)设置值为何,均允许存取的特殊通用寄存
器。
Acquisition
Time
(
TACQ
,采集时间)
该时间与模
拟数字(
A/D
)转换器有关。它是
P
IC18CXXX
A/D
上的保持电容充电到模拟输入
电压电平时的时间。
’当
GO
位置
1
时,模拟输入与保持电容断开,
A/D
转换开始。
A/D
指的是模拟数字转换器。见“
Analog-to-
Digital
(
A/D
,模拟数字
转换)
”的说明。
ALU
算术逻辑单元。器件上负责
数学(加、减?)
、逻辑(与、或?)和移位运算的逻辑单元。
Analog
(模拟)
指通过将不同频率或幅值的信号叠加到给定频率的载波上进行
电子传输的过程。
Analog-
to-Digital
(
A/D
,模
拟数字转换)
将一个模拟输入电压转换到与之成正比的数字值的过程。
汇编语言
将二进制机器码描述成可读形式的符号语言。
AUSART
< br>可寻址通用同步异步收发器。
该模块可作为一个全双工异步通讯口运行,
也可作为一个半双工同
步通讯口运行。当运行在异步模式下时,
USART
可与一台
PC
的串行端口连接。
Alphan
umeric
(字母数字符)
p>
字母数字符包括字母和
0
到
9
的数字。
Application
(应用)
用户开发的一整套软硬件结合体,通常是一个由
PICmicro?
单片机控制的产品。
Assemble
(汇编)
汇编器所做的事。见
assembl
er
(汇编器)
。
Assembler
(汇编器)
一种将用户的汇编源代码(
.asm
)译成机器码的语言工具。
MPASM
?是
Microchip
的汇编器。
Assembly
(汇编语言)
最终由机器语言取代的编程语言。
机
器语言完全由数字组成,
人们几乎无法识别和读写。
汇编语
p>
言与机器语言的结构和命令集相同,但允许程序员使用名称(指令)取代数字进行编程。
p>
Assigned
Section
(赋值段)
在链接器命令文件中赋值到目标存储器区块的段。链接器将赋
值段分配给特定的目标存储器块。
Bank
(存储体)
是一种对数据存储器寻址的方法。由于增强型器件具备
8
位直接寻址功能,指令可寻址到
256
p>
字节。
为了使器件能具备多个数据存储器,
将数据存储器分区为相邻的存储体,
每个存储体包含
256
p>
字节的数据。要选择所需的存储体,需对存储体选择寄存器(
BSR
)进行正确配置。共可
实现
16
个存储体。
Baud
(波特)
通常用它来描述串行端口的通讯速度的快慢。与每秒位速(<
/p>
bps
)相当。
BCD
见“
Binary
Coded
Decimal
(BCD
,二进制码
十进制小数
)
”中的说明。
Binary
Coded
Decimal
(
BCD
,二进制码十进制小数)
其每
4
位表示一个
0-9
的十进制数。通常一个字节包含
0-99
的两位
十进制数。
BOR
见“
Brown-out
Reset
(
BOR
,掉电复位)
”中的说明。
Brown-out
(掉电)
当电源电压短时跌落到规定最小工作电压以下的情况。当电路
中负载增加时可使系统
/
器件的电
压下
降,而导致这种情况的发生。
Brown-out
Reset
(
BOR
,掉电复位)
当电源电压跌落到规定电压范围以下时,迫使器件进入复位状
态的电路。有些器件具备内部
BO
R
电
路,而其它器件则需要外部电路才可产生掉电复位。
Bus
width
(总线宽度)
这是总线可运载信息的位数。对数据存储器来说,总线宽度为
8
位。对增强型器件,程序存储
器总线
宽度为
16
位。
Breakpoint
–
Hardware
(断点
–
硬件)
一种执行后会导致程序暂停的事件。
Breakpoint
–
Software
(断点
–
软件)
一个执行固件后程序暂停的地址。通常由一个特殊的断点操作
符得到。
Build
(重编译)
对一个应用的源代码进行重新编译的功能。
C
一种高级编程语言,可用于为
PICmicro?
MCU
,特别是高端器件系列产生代码。
Calibration
Memory
(校准存储器)
用于保存
PICmicro?
单片机板上
RC
振荡器校准值的特殊功能寄存
器。
CAN
控制器局域网。一种针对汽车和工业应用的外设接口。
Capture
(捕捉)
CCP
模块的一种功能,
当预定事件发生时,
定时器
/
计数器的值被
“捕捉”
到保持寄存器模块中。
Capture
Register
(捕捉寄存器)
是一种
16
位寄存器,当捕捉事件发生时将
TMR1
寄存器中的
16
位值装入该寄存器。
CCP
捕捉、比较和脉宽调制(
PWM
)
。<
/p>
CCP
模块可配置作为输入捕捉、定时器比较或
< br>PWM
输出运
行。
COFF
通用目标文件格式。一种由
MPLINK
?
< br>
LINKER
链接器生成的包含机器码和调试信息的中
间文
件格式。
Command
Line
Interface
(命令行界面)
命令行界面指的是在
DOS
下执行一条带选项的命令。执行
MPASM
?<
/p>
汇编器和任一命令行选项
或文件名将调
用该汇编器。当命令行选项缺省时,将执行默认输入界面。
Common
RAM
(共用
RAM
)
是数据存储器
RAM
上在所有存储体中地址相同
的区。该通用
RAM
可在
70h
-
7Fh
(含)
的地
址间实现。它对于上下文转换期间(如中断期间)的保存所需变量是很有用处的
。
Compare
(比较)
CCP
模块的功能之一,当定时器的
寄存器值与比较寄存器中的值相符时器件将执行一个动作。
Compare
Register
(比较寄存器)
是一种
16
位寄存器,
包含一个与
16
位
TMR1
寄存器相比较的值。
当计数器与比较寄
存器中的
内容相符时,比较功能模块将被触发。
Compile
(编译)
编译器所做的事。见“
compil
er
(编译器)
”
。
< br>
Compiler
(编译器)
一种将用户的
C
语言源代码译成机器码的语言工具。
MPLAB?
C17
和
MPLAB?
C18
均为
M
icroch
ip
公司的
C
编译器,分别用于
PIC17CXXX
和
PIC18CXXX<
/p>
器件的编译。
Configuration
Bits
(配置位)
用于编译设置
PICmicro?<
/p>
单片机运行模式的位。配置位不一定需要预编程。对于模拟器和仿真
器,可通过
Options
>
Development
Mode
对话框设置;对于编程器可在
_
_
CONFIG
MPASM
?指令中设置。
Configuration
Word
(配置字)
这是非易失性存储器位置,它规定了器件运行的一些特征(如
振荡模式,
WTD
的使能,起动定
时器
的使能)
。
这些特征均可在器件编程时进行规定。
对于
EPROM
存储器,
只
要某位的值为
“
1
”
< br>,
均可在日后编程为“
0
”
p>
;如果值为“
0
”
,必须先擦除器件后再编程为“
1
”
。
Conversion
Time
(
Tconv
,转换时间)
该时间与
模拟数字(
A/D
)转换器相关。这是
PIC18CXXX
A/D
转换器将保持电容上的模拟电
p>
平转换成数字值所需的时间。
CPU
中央处理单元。
将指令解码并决定程序执行所需的操作数并负责运算。
将数学运算、
逻辑运算和
移位运算传送到
ALU
。
D/A
见“
Digital
to
Analog
(数字模拟转换)
”的说明。
DAC
数字模拟转换器。
Data
Bus
(数据总线)
将数据传送到数据存储器或从数据存储器传送回来的总线。
Data
EEPROM
(数据
EEPROM
)
数据电可擦除可编程只读存储器。该存储器可由
CPU
编程和再编程,以确保在掉电时关键值
/
p>
关键变量被保存在非易失性存储器中。
Data
Memory
(数据存储器)
在数据总线上的存储器。该存储器是易失的(
SRAM
)
,包含特殊功能寄存器和通用寄存器。
p>
Data
Memory
(数据存储器)
被仿真的
PICmicro?
器件上
RAM
的通用文件寄存器(
GPR
)
。文件寄存器窗口显示数据存储
器。
Digital-to-
Analog
(数字模拟转换)
从数字值转换到与之成正比的模拟电压的过程。
Direct
Addressing
(直接寻址)
指令中包含数据存储器地址的情况。执行这种类型的指令将总
是访问嵌入地址的数据。
Directives
(指令)
指令通过告知
MPASM
?汇编器如何处理助记符、定义数据、格式和列表文件来对汇编器操作进
行
控制。指令简化了编码并可根据特殊要求对输出进行定制。
Download
(下载)
下载是将数据从
PC
主机上传送到另一台设备,如仿真器、编程器或目标板的过程。
EEPROM
< br>电可擦除可编程只读存储器。是一种电可擦除的特殊类型的
PROM
。数据被逐个字节地擦除。
即使在电源被切断时,
E
EPROM
也会将其中的内容保存下来。
Embedded
System
(嵌入式系统)
内建或集成到器件上的一种特殊功能计算机。
用于控制、
监控和协助运行。
所有嵌入式系统均包
p>
含计算机,其中最简单的一种为单片微处理器(
“芯片”
)
。可将微处理器进行设计以添加某种功
能的
p>
ROM
软件(
“固件”
)
,如
PC
的
ROM
BIOS
。
(定义来源于
ChipCenter
.com
)
p>
Emulation
(仿真)
开发时执行安装在仿真存储器中的软件,如同执行安装在单片
机中的固件一样。
Emulation
Memory
(仿真存储器)
仿真器中的程序存储器。
Emulator
(仿真器)
进行仿真的硬件。
Emulator
System
(仿真系统)
MPLAB?
ICE
仿真系统包含线夹、处理器模块、器件适配器、电缆以及
MPLAB?
软件。
PIC
MASTER?
仿真系统包含线夹、针对不同器件的不同探针、电缆以及
MPLAB?
软件。
EPROM
电可编程只读存储器。该存储器能够在线编程。要擦除它必须
将其置于紫外线下。
Event
(事件)
说明一个总线循环,包括地址、数据、通过次数、外部输入、
循环类型(取指,
R/W
)及时间
戳等
。用事件来描述触发器和断点。
Executable
Code
(可执行代码)
见
Hex
Code
(十六进制代码)
。
Export
(引出)
将数据以标准格式从
MPLAB?
IDE
中传送出来。
Expressions
(表达式)
表达式用于
MPASM
?汇编器源代码行的操作数字段,包含常量、符号或由算术运算符分隔的常
量
和符号的任意组合。每个常量或符号均前置正负号以表示表达式的正负。
External
RAM
(外部
RAM
,仅限
PIC17CXXX
和
PIC18CXXX
器件)
非片上读
/
写存储器。
EXTRC
外部阻容(
RC
)
。有些器件具备允许来自外部
RC
时钟的器件振荡器选项。与一些器件上的
RC<
/p>
模式相同。
Flash
(闪速)
EEPROM
的一种类型,数据被逐
个区块擦除而不是逐个字节擦除。
FLASH
Memory
(闪存)
这种存储器能够在线编程和擦除。存储器的编程技术在功能上
与
EEPROM
存储器几乎相同。
FOSC
器件振荡器的频率。
File
Registers
(文件寄存器)
片上通用和特殊功能寄存器。
GIO
通用输入
/
输出。
GPIO
通用输入
/
输出。
GPR
通用寄存器(
RAM
)
。可用于存储动
态程序变量的那部分数据存储器。
Harvard
Architecture
< br>(哈佛结构)
在哈佛结构中
,
程序存储器和数据存储器是相互隔离的。
它使对数据存储器和
程序存储器的访问
可同时进行,提高了器件的性能。
PICmi
cro?
器件采用哈佛结构。
Hex
Code
(十六进制代码)
将源代码汇编或编译成标准十六进制格式代码的可执行指令,
也称可执行码或机器码。
十六进制
代码
被保存在
hex
file
(十六进制文件)中。
Hex
File
(十六进制文件)
一种
ASCII
文件,包含适合进行器件编程的十六进制地址和值
(十六进制代码)
。
本格式可由器
件编程器读取。
High
Level
Language
(高级语言)
与汇编代码相比,用于编写程序的高级语言对处理器进行了更
高水平的提取。高级语言(如
C
语言)利用编译器将语句译成目
标处理器能够处理的机器指令。
Holding
Capacitor
(保持电容)
这是模拟数字(
A/D
)模块中的一个电容,它在转换开始时“保持”模拟输入电平。信号采集期
间
,保持电容被模拟输入引脚充电
/
放电。转换开始时,保持电容
从模拟输入端断开并将该电压
“保持”以进行
A/D
转换。
HS
(
High
Speed
,高速)
高速。是器件振荡模式的一种。应调整振荡电路以支持高频运
行。目前它支持
4
MHz
至
25
M
Hz
的运行频率。
I2C?
内部互联电路。这是一种双线通讯接口。它是“
SSP
”和“
MSSP
”模块模式的特性之一。
ICD
在线调试器。
MPLAB?
ICD<
/p>
是
Microchip
公司针对
PIC16F87X
器件的在线调试器。
MPL
AB
?
ICD
在
MPLAB?
IDE
下使用。
ICE
在线仿真器。
MPLAB?
ICE<
/p>
是
Mcrochip
公司的在线仿真器,
在
MPLAB?
IDE
下使用。
IDE
集成开发环境。是一种具备多种功能的固件开发应用程序。
MPLAB?
IDE
在
Windows?
应用
程序上集成了编译器、汇编器、项目管理器、编辑器、调试器、模拟器以及一系列其
它工具。进
行应用开发的用户可无须离开
MPLAB?
IDE
桌面即可编写代
码、编译、调试和测试应用。
Identifier
(标识符)
函数或变量的名称。
Import
(引入)
将数据从外部信号源传送进
MPLAB?
IDE
,如数据可来自一个十六进制文件。
Indirect
Addressing
(间接寻址)
当指令中不包含数据存储器地址时,指令在
< br>INDF
地址执行,从而使数据存储器地址成为
FSR<
/p>
寄存器中的值。指令的执行将总是访问
FSR
寄存器所指向地址的数据。
Initialized
Data
(初始数据)
由初始值定义的数据。在
C
语言中,
int
myVar=5;
定义的变量将驻留在初始数据区中。
Instruction
Bus
(指令总线)
用于将指令字从程序存储器传送进
C
PU
的总线。
Instruction
Cycle
(指令周期)
指令执行的事件。有四种事件,分别描述为:解码,读取,执
行和写入。指令并不同时执行所有
事件。欲了解指令周期期间的操作,请查看每条指令的
有关说明。四个外部时钟(
TOSC
)组成
一个指令周期(
TCY
)
。
Instruction
Fetch
(取指令)
在哈佛结构下,欲执行一条指令时,下一个程序存储器中的地
址将被“取出”
,并在当前指令执
行完毕时立即被解码。
Interrupt
(中断)
向
CPU
发
出的信号,迫使程序流程进入中断矢量地址(程序存储器中的
04h
)
。程序流程改变
前,程序计数器中的内容被迫进入硬件堆
栈,从而使程序执行返回中断点。
INTRC
内部阻容(
RC
)
。有些器件具备允许时钟来自内部
RC
电路的器件振荡器选项。
KEELOQ?
KEELOQ?
是一种专利跳码技术。
Microch
ip
的
KEELOQ?
产品为单向传输
提供了一种数据加
密方法,即使按下同一按钮发送的代码也各不相同。
< br>
LCD
液晶显示器。用于为系统提供状态显示。它可能需要定制
LCD
玻璃的规格。
LED
发光二极管。用于为系统提供状态显示。
Librarian
(库管理员)
一种创建和操纵库的语言工具。
MP
LIB
?是
Microchip
的库管
理员。
Library
(库)
库是可重新定位的目标模块的集合。
将多个源文件编译成目标文件,
然后用库管理员将各个目标
文件
结合成一个库文件即可创建一个库。
可将一个库与多个目标模块和其它库链接形成可执行
代
码。
LIN
Protocol
Spec
ification
(
LIN
协议规范
)
是一种低成本、
短距离的低速网络,
设计用于传输开关设置的变化并响应开关变化。
应用于大量
汽车子系统中。
Link
(链接)
-
-
-
-
-
-
-
-
-
上一篇:描写乌云的短句和诗词
下一篇:英文柔印术语